Financials Venlon Enterprises Limited

Equities

VENLONENT6

INE204D01022

Commodity Chemicals

Market Closed - Bombay S.E. 11:00:56 26/06/2024 BST 5-day change 1st Jan Change
5.48 INR +0.92% Intraday chart for Venlon Enterprises Limited -1.97% +11.84%

Valuation

Fiscal Period: March 2018 2019 2020 2021 2022 2023
Capitalization 1 216.8 156.7 89.33 124.9 203.7 187.6
Enterprise Value (EV) 1 1,436 1,406 1,260 1,213 1,246 1,281
P/E ratio -2.81 x -0.67 x -1.44 x -3 x 20.5 x -661 x
Yield - - - - - -
Capitalization / Revenue 0.63 x 0.63 x 2.71 x 11.4 x 5.36 x 7.87 x
EV / Revenue 4.16 x 5.65 x 38.2 x 111 x 32.8 x 53.8 x
EV / EBITDA 117 x -33.1 x -61.2 x -52.4 x 52.9 x -52.8 x
EV / FCF -45.4 x 17 x 19.4 x 22.4 x 31.7 x 46.9 x
FCF Yield -2.2% 5.9% 5.17% 4.46% 3.15% 2.13%
Price to Book 2.45 x -0.41 x -0.17 x -0.23 x -0.38 x -0.24 x
Nbr of stocks (in thousands) 52,242 52,242 52,242 52,242 52,242 52,242
Reference price 2 4.150 3.000 1.710 2.390 3.900 3.590
Announcement Date 05/09/18 05/09/19 01/09/20 31/08/21 06/09/22 06/09/23
1INR in Million2INR
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: March 2018 2019 2020 2021 2022 2023
Net sales 1 345 248.8 32.99 10.92 38.03 23.82
EBITDA 1 12.24 -42.51 -20.57 -23.18 23.54 -24.28
EBIT 1 -36.63 -91.5 -54.48 -57 -10.17 -72.9
Operating Margin -10.62% -36.78% -165.12% -521.91% -26.74% -306.01%
Earnings before Tax (EBT) 1 -77.07 -185.8 -62.02 -42.64 27.33 -331.5
Net income 1 -77.07 -235.3 -62.02 -41.57 10.1 -0.054
Net margin -22.34% -94.57% -187.96% -380.63% 26.56% -0.23%
EPS 2 -1.475 -4.503 -1.187 -0.7957 0.1903 -0.005430
Free Cash Flow 1 -31.66 82.94 65.08 54.17 39.3 27.31
FCF margin -9.18% 33.34% 197.25% 495.99% 103.33% 114.64%
FCF Conversion (EBITDA) - - - - 166.89% -
FCF Conversion (Net income) - - - - 388.98% -
Dividend per Share - - - - - -
Announcement Date 05/09/18 05/09/19 01/09/20 31/08/21 06/09/22 06/09/23
1INR in Million2INR
Estimates

Balance Sheet Analysis

Fiscal Period: March 2018 2019 2020 2021 2022 2023
Net Debt 1 1,219 1,249 1,170 1,088 1,042 1,093
Net Cash position 1 - - - - - -
Leverage (Debt/EBITDA) 99.62 x -29.38 x -56.89 x -46.96 x 44.26 x -45.04 x
Free Cash Flow 1 -31.7 82.9 65.1 54.2 39.3 27.3
ROE (net income / shareholders' equity) -50.5% 159% 13.7% 8.07% -5.09% 50%
ROA (Net income/ Total Assets) -1.62% -5.02% -3.84% -4.26% -0.78% -6.17%
Assets 1 4,770 4,684 1,615 975.6 -1,302 0.8747
Book Value Per Share 2 1.690 -7.340 -10.00 -10.20 -10.30 -15.00
Cash Flow per Share 2 0.0300 0.0200 0.0100 0.6700 0.0400 0.0300
Capex 1 3.71 3.85 - - - -
Capex / Sales 1.08% 1.55% - - - -
Announcement Date 05/09/18 05/09/19 01/09/20 31/08/21 06/09/22 06/09/23
1INR in Million2INR
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

  1. Stock Market
  2. Equities
  3. VENLONENT6 Stock
  4. Financials Venlon Enterprises Limited